Job Description: Job Title: Senior Solution Architect Healthcare & Financial Services Role Summary We are seeking an experienced Solution Architect with deep, end-to-end architecture capabilities across data, application, integration, and user-facing layers, with proven experience in healthcare and financial services environments. This role goes beyond data architecture alone. We are seeking candidates with end-to-end solution architecture capabilitiesnot only strong data architecture skills, but also experience in application architecture, user-facing design, and financial domain integration. The architect will own solution designs from concept through implementation, ensuring they are scalable, secure, compliant, and aligned with enterprise standards across highly regulated domains. Core Responsibilities End-to-End Solution Architecture Own and design full-stack solution architectures, spanning: User-facing applications (web, mobile, portals) Application and service layers (microservices, APIs) Integration and middleware layers Data platforms (operational, analytical, and streaming) Translate complex business, clinical, and financial requirements into logical and physical architecture designs. Define architecture patterns, standards, and reference implementations across domains. Application & Integration Architecture Design application architectures using modern paradigms such as: Microservices and domain-driven design Event-driven and message-based systems API-first and service-oriented architectures Lead integrations across internal and external systems, including: Healthcare platforms (EMRs, payer systems, interoperability hubs) Financial platforms (payment gateways, billing, invoicing, risk and compliance systems) Define API specifications, data contracts, and integration patterns (REST, GraphQL, async messaging, ETL). Data & Analytics Architecture Design and govern data architectures supporting transactional, analytical, and reporting use cases. Model healthcare and financial domain data, ensuring accuracy, lineage, and regulatory compliance. Support architectures involving data warehouses, data lakes, streaming pipelines, and analytics platforms. User-Facing & Experience Considerations Partner with UX/UI, product, and engineering teams to ensure user-facing solutions are performant, intuitive, and scalable. Ensure architectural decisions support usability, accessibility, and workflows across clinical, operational, and financial users. Security, Compliance & Governance Architect solutions that meet healthcare and financial regulatory requirements, including HIPAA, HITRUST, SOC 2, PCI-DSS, and data privacy standards. Embed security controls into application, data, and integration layers (IAM, encryption, auditing, tokenization). Participate in architecture review boards and ensure adherence to enterprise and domain standards. Delivery & Leadership Provide hands-on guidance to engineering teams during build, test, and deployment. Evaluate tradeoffs related to scalability, performance, cost, and technical debt. Mentor senior engineers and architects; influence architecture decisions across multiple initiatives. Communicate architecture decisions clearly to technical and non-technical stakeholders. Required Qualifications 710+ years of experience in solution, application, or enterprise architecture. Strong experience designing end-to-end solutions, not limited to data platforms. Proven work in healthcare and/or financial services environments. Expertise in modern application architecture (microservices, APIs, cloud-native patterns). Strong integration experience across heterogeneous systems and vendors. Hands-on experience with cloud platforms (Azure, AWS, or GCP). Solid understanding of security, compliance, and privacy in regulated industries. Ability to operate at both strategic and hands-on technical levels. Preferred / Nice-to-Have Healthcare standards: HL7, FHIR, X12, EDI, interoperability frameworks. Financial domain experience: payments, billing, revenue cycle, risk, fraud, compliance. Experience modernizing legacy platforms or leading cloud migration initiatives. DevOps, CI/CD, Infrastructure as Code (Terraform, ARM, CloudFormation). Architecture certifications (Azure/AWS Architect, TOGAF).
